a lack of relation
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"a lack of relation"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e a situation where there is no connection or association between two or more things. Example: "The study revealed a lack of relation between the variables, indicating that they do not influence each other."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When using "a lack of relation", ensure that the context clearly indicates what two or more elements are not related. Avoid ambiguity by specifying the subjects involved.
Common error
Avoid using "a lack of relation" in overly complex sentences where simpler phrasing would improve clarity. For example, instead of "Due to a lack of relation between A and B, the results were inconclusive", consider "Because A and B are unrelated, the results were inconclusive."

FAQs
How can I use "a lack of relation" in a sentence?
You can use "a lack of relation" to describe situations where there's no connection between two or more things. For example: "The study revealed a lack of relation between the variables".
What can I say instead of "a lack of relation"?
You can use alternatives like "an absence of connection", "a disconnect", or "no correlation" depending on the context.
Is it better to say "lack of relation" or "lack of relationship"?
"Lack of relation" generally refers to a more abstract connection or correlation, while "lack of relationship" typically implies an interpersonal connection. The better choice depends on the intended meaning.
What's the difference between "a lack of relation" and "unrelated"?
"A lack of relation" is a noun phrase describing the absence of connection, whereas "unrelated" is an adjective describing items that are not connected. For example, "There is a lack of relation between the two events" vs. "The two events are unrelated".
